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Inventory Lab
- InventoryLab is no longer sold standalone and is now bundled into Three Colts' Seller 365 plans starting at $69 per month for a single user, rising to $199 per month for the Pro tier
- Multichannel listing requires the separate UniCon add-on, priced from $49 to $449 per month depending on tier
Toast
- Starter tier lacks advanced features; most capabilities require paid plans above $69/month
- No free tier for advanced features like employee scheduling, inventory, or loyalty programs
- Setup and training time required for complex multi-location deployments
- Payment processing tied to Toast ecosystem; limited flexibility for alternative payment processors
- Hardware costs can be substantial for full-featured setups with multiple terminals and kitchen displays

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Toast: What is the cost of Toast POS?
Toast offers a free Starter Kit tier for one or two terminals with POS and payment processing at no upfront cost, though costs are built into payment processing rates. Paid plans start at $69/month for the Point of Sale plan, with Custom tier available via quote for advanced features.
SourceToast: Does Toast include online ordering?
Yes. Toast offers online ordering capabilities where customers can order via QR code while seated (Order & Pay) or through standalone online ordering integrated with the POS for kitchen automation.
SourceToast: Does Toast offer drive-through capabilities?
Yes. In April 2026, Toast launched a drive-thru product supporting voice ordering through integrations, allowing restaurants to automate drive-through workflows.
